Ibanez

The Ibanez brand name dates back to 1929 when Hoshino Gakki began importing Salvador Ibanez guitars from Spain. From this modest beginning, The Ibanez brand name has grown to be one of the largest names in quality instrument manufacturing with hundreds of products ranging from acoustic and electric and bass guitars to some of the most sought after effect pedals and instrument amplifiers.

DBZ Guitars by Dean Zelinsky

Dean B. Zelinsky had founded Dean Guitars in the late 1970’s beating almost all odds by creating a line of guitars that for a 20-year-old to take on the biggest manufacturers in the world and  rise above the clutter to become a household name.

In 2009 Dean Zelinsky ventured out on his own to begin fresh, away from the corporate entity that Dean guitars had become. Instead of a sales game about numbers he could concentrate on creating quality instruments designed for players.
